New wheels and tires mounted: Volk LE37t 19x9.5 +22 front (with 5mm spacer for +17 net offset) with 245/35/19, 19x10.5 +22 rear (with 10mm spacer for +12 net offset) with 275/35/19 Hankook Ventus evo v12's. Muteki neon-chrome lugnuts for fun. Also removed / plugged the rear wiper to clean up the car's profile.

I've heard that the 2011-2012 STi's have a fuel eco mode built-in which can get something like 30+ mpg on the highway (while my stg 2 sti is getting maybe 24mpg at 75-80mph), but I don't really know whether that's true, and late model STi's are still a prohibitive amount of coin to get into. When you do go to buy your STi, make sure you get compression and leakdown tests done. Lots of cracked piston ringlands out there. If/when the time comes feel free to shoot me some questions, I may be able to steer you clear of potential problem$. |
